      @@dogedoge4840 The count isn't as strict as some fans seem to believe it is. If it was, they'd use the timekeeper at ringside, and they would always count even if the fighter was out cold rather than waving it off. The count is just there to give the ref time to see if a fighter can continue to defend himself, it's not some kind of time trap. Here is what the ref said about the long count -
      "At the count of eight, Douglas started to get up and I saw that he knew what was going on. He lifted his head, hit the canvas in a sign of disgust, which told me he was ready to continue the fight, the time was up and possibly Tyson would have won, but Douglas demonstrated that he was well-prepared in the next round. Douglas was well-prepared physically. His punches were always good and he stood up to everything Tyson threw.”
